NP (SL) Limited’s staff have benefited from a Breast Cancer awareness talk from the Well Woman Clinic (MEPS Trust) at the Company’s headquarters.

The purpose of the health talk is to raise awareness about the disease among staff, as Breast Cancer remains one of the leading causes of death for women globally.
The session was facilitated by the Head Sister of the Well Woman Clinic, Madam Adijatu Salam, who led discussions on the predisposing factors, causes, signs and symptoms, diagnostic procedures, treatment options, and examination methods related to breast cancer.

According to Madam Salam, Cancer is the uncontrolled growth of abnormal cells, and Breast Cancer is Cancer of the breast. She stated that studies have found that fat, heredity, stress, poor diet, lack of exercise and smoking are some of the predisposing factors of Breast Cancer. She added that a lump in the breast, an inverted nipple and asymmetric breasts are some of the signs and symptoms of the disease. “Men can also develop Breast Cancer. Individuals of all races and backgrounds can be affected by Breast Cancer. Except hair and nails, all parts of the human body can be attacked by Cancer.”

Speaking about healthy lifestyles to limit one’s chances of getting the disease, Madam Salam advised that eating vegetables, fruits, exercising regularly, and drinking plenty of water help deter Breast Cancer and several other diseases.
Staff members shared their thoughts and concerns regarding Breast Cancer. The health awareness talk concluded with a self-examination session and further expert breast screening.

October is recognized globally as Breast Cancer Awareness Month. In alignment with NP-SL’s health values, the Company partners with Well Woman Clinic every October to commemorate Breast Cancer, raising awareness and celebrating the strength and resilience of those affected by the disease, including survivors and medical personnel.
